Gangassa means "carbet" in Sranan-Tongo, the language of the Black-Brown people from whom Malori, a charming Surinamese, hails, and who will generously welcome you to his beautiful space. The place is just as suitable for families who want to spread out their hammocks in the peace and quiet of a small carbet, as it is for large groups who will enjoy using the outside area for various sporting activities, the communal carbet for meals, or the creek for swimming. Remember to bring your own bottles, as there is no drinking water on site.
